A line with a slope of -2 is written in the form y=mx+b.

what is the value of b If the line passes through the point (5,-7)?​

Answer:

b = 3

Explanation:

The equation of a line in slope- intercept form is

y = mx + b ( m is the slope and b the y- intercept )

Here m = - 2 , then

y = - 2x + b ← is the partial equation

To find b substitute (5, - 7 ) into the partial equation

- 7 = - 10 + b ⇒ b = - 7 + 10 = 3
